Built by Blackie
Felix “Blackie” Jumason is a software engineer, Cursor Regional Lead for Africa and developer-community builder based in Kenya. His work explores AI agents, developer tooling, infrastructure and practical technology for African communities. BlackieLabs is the home for his products, open-source projects and engineering experiments.
